**Vendor note: Inkmill markdown pipeline**

Rendering for Parchway docs is outsourced to Inkmill under an annual contract, renewing each March. They handle sanitization and PDF export; we own the upload queue. SLA: 4-hour response on rendering failures. Escalate only after two failed retries. Their support desk is reachable at the address below.

billing contact of hahaf-baguf = zorael.tammir.jorius@sivrelhq.internal

Subject: Password reset revamp — rollout details

Hi Tomas,

Ahead of Friday's release, the Quillgate reset flow now issues single-use links that expire after fifteen minutes, and the legacy email template has been retired. Partner integrations at Ferrowind must switch to the v3 endpoint before cutover; the v2 route returns a deprecation warning until then. For smoke-testing against the sandbox, authenticate the verification calls with the following token.

session JWT of yawep-yawep = eyJhbGciOiJIUzI1NiIsInR5cCI6IkpXVCJ9.eyJzdWIiOiI3pWF3_In0.aXYsHiog

## Migration Step 4 — Quillgate Socket Layer

The reconnect loop fix requires upgrading the Quillgate client to the v3 handshake. Old clients retried without jitter, hammering the broker after restarts. Verify jitter and max-retry caps are enforced server-side before cutover. Apply the following configuration values to the broker before restarting it.

service settings:
[istox]
host = istox.qorvelforge.internal
user = istox_svc
database = istox_prod

## Sorting Stability — Quillforge Report Builder

The Quillforge report builder relies on a stable sort when grouping rows; the legacy comparator was not stable and caused nondeterministic exports, so we replaced it with a stable merge implementation in release 4.2. Maintainers must not revert to the native sort. Signed export templates guarantee the stable path is used; templates are validated against the key below.

signing key of bagap-yawep = bky13_TbfT6ZMUoGJo2